mirror of
https://github.com/VCMP-SqMod/SqMod.git
synced 2024-11-08 00:37:15 +01:00
Fix the TCC module project for windows builds.
This commit is contained in:
parent
29da6850e4
commit
1a18c3fd78
@ -17,6 +17,7 @@
|
||||
<Add option="-g" />
|
||||
<Add option="-D_DEBUG" />
|
||||
<Add option="-DTCC_TARGET_I386" />
|
||||
<Add option="-DTCC_TARGET_PE" />
|
||||
<Add directory="../config/mingw32" />
|
||||
</Compiler>
|
||||
<Linker>
|
||||
@ -38,6 +39,7 @@
|
||||
<Add option="-m32" />
|
||||
<Add option="-DNDEBUG" />
|
||||
<Add option="-DTCC_TARGET_I386" />
|
||||
<Add option="-DTCC_TARGET_PE" />
|
||||
<Add directory="../config/mingw32" />
|
||||
</Compiler>
|
||||
<Linker>
|
||||
@ -61,6 +63,7 @@
|
||||
<Add option="-D_DEBUG" />
|
||||
<Add option="-D_SQ64" />
|
||||
<Add option="-DTCC_TARGET_X86_64" />
|
||||
<Add option="-DTCC_TARGET_PE" />
|
||||
<Add directory="../config/mingw64" />
|
||||
</Compiler>
|
||||
<Linker>
|
||||
@ -83,6 +86,7 @@
|
||||
<Add option="-DNDEBUG" />
|
||||
<Add option="-D_SQ64" />
|
||||
<Add option="-DTCC_TARGET_X86_64" />
|
||||
<Add option="-DTCC_TARGET_PE" />
|
||||
<Add directory="../config/mingw64" />
|
||||
</Compiler>
|
||||
<Linker>
|
||||
@ -188,6 +192,7 @@
|
||||
<Add option="-enable-static" />
|
||||
<Add option="-D_DEBUG" />
|
||||
<Add option="-DTCC_TARGET_I386" />
|
||||
<Add option="-DTCC_TARGET_PE" />
|
||||
<Add directory="../config/mingw32" />
|
||||
</Compiler>
|
||||
<Linker>
|
||||
@ -213,6 +218,7 @@
|
||||
<Add option="-enable-static" />
|
||||
<Add option="-DNDEBUG" />
|
||||
<Add option="-DTCC_TARGET_I386" />
|
||||
<Add option="-DTCC_TARGET_PE" />
|
||||
<Add directory="../config/mingw32" />
|
||||
</Compiler>
|
||||
<Linker>
|
||||
@ -240,6 +246,7 @@
|
||||
<Add option="-D_DEBUG" />
|
||||
<Add option="-D_SQ64" />
|
||||
<Add option="-DTCC_TARGET_X86_64" />
|
||||
<Add option="-DTCC_TARGET_PE" />
|
||||
<Add directory="../config/mingw64" />
|
||||
</Compiler>
|
||||
<Linker>
|
||||
@ -266,6 +273,7 @@
|
||||
<Add option="-DNDEBUG" />
|
||||
<Add option="-D_SQ64" />
|
||||
<Add option="-DTCC_TARGET_X86_64" />
|
||||
<Add option="-DTCC_TARGET_PE" />
|
||||
<Add directory="../config/mingw64" />
|
||||
</Compiler>
|
||||
<Linker>
|
||||
@ -392,7 +400,7 @@
|
||||
</Compiler>
|
||||
<Unit filename="../external/TCC/libtcc.c">
|
||||
<Option compilerVar="CC" />
|
||||
<Option compiler="gcc" use="1" buildCommand="$compiler -Wno-unused-parameter -Wno-unused-function -Wno-sign-compare -Wno-pointer-sign -Wno-missing-field-initializers -Wno-maybe-uninitialized -Wno-return-type $options $includes -c $file -o $object" />
|
||||
<Option compiler="gcc" use="1" buildCommand="$compiler -Wno-unused-parameter -Wno-unused-function -Wno-sign-compare -Wno-pointer-sign -Wno-missing-field-initializers -Wno-maybe-uninitialized -Wno-return-type -Wno-format $options $includes -c $file -o $object" />
|
||||
</Unit>
|
||||
<Unit filename="../modules/tcc/API.cpp" />
|
||||
<Unit filename="../modules/tcc/Common.cpp" />
|
||||
|
Loading…
Reference in New Issue
Block a user